Abstract
The invention relates to a sealing device for repair of cardiac and vascular defects or tissue opening such as a patent foramen ovale (PFO) or shunt in the heart, the vascular system, etc. and particularly provides an occluder device and trans-catheter occluder delivery system. The sealing device would have improved conformity to heart anatomy and be easily deployed, repositioned, and retrieved at the opening site.

13. A method of delivering a medical device to a delivery site within a patient, comprising:
-
releasably coupling a medical device with a deployment handle, the deployment handle comprising a first tube extending from an end of the housing, a second tube configured to retract within the first tube, a third tube configured to retract within the second tube, a channel having a length portion arranged along at least a partial length of the housing, and at least one linear actuator configured to move within the channel along the length thereof, the medical device comprising an expandable frame having a plurality of struts extending from a proximal end to a distal end of the frame; and transitioning the third tube within the second tube and the second tube within the first tube based on a position of the at least one linear actuator within the channel. - View Dependent Claims (14, 15, 16, 17)
